Output 1030deaa476f162efdea0cf2f94fbd0d7432dc8d93b68f2d99d04c5afcdd95f8:0

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84c6eac4b52bf65bd357328071a08ad8e0a1a3da OP_EQUAL
address
3Do5Qs93MK9ub1PVStfZMbCmyYEMX2YRba
transaction
1030deaa476f162efdea0cf2f94fbd0d7432dc8d93b68f2d99d04c5afcdd95f8
spent
true